As of 2023, the import of cotton toilet and kitchen linen of terry towelling or similar terry fabrics to the US stands at 356.5 million kilograms. Forecast data indicate a steady increase from 2024 through 2028, with values rising from 362.96 to 388.35 million kilograms. The year-on-year growth from 2024 is projected to vary, showing consistent annual increases. The compound annual growth rate (CAGR) for the years 2024 to 2028 is approximately 1.75%, reflecting a gradual upward trend in imports over this period.
